Delegate Kathy Tran’s Response to Musk/Trump Firings of Federal Workforce and Governor Youngkin’s Support for These Cuts

February 26, 2025

The mass firing of thousands of federal workers by the Musk/Trump Administration is wrong and deeply damaging to families and communities throughout Virginia.

Virginia is home to nearly 145,000 federal workers in addition to countless federal contractors and grantees. As a former civil servant at the US Department of Labor, I know firsthand the dedication, expertise, and professionalism with which our federal workers serve our nation and embody the values of public service.

Constituents have reached out to me to share their concerns, from how they will be able to put food on the table to paying their rent or mortgage to caring for their families. We also know that the decimation of the federal workforce will affect the availability of a range of government services upon which Virginians depend. The impacts on the people of Virginia and to our communities are real and severe.

I am deeply concerned by Governor Youngkin’s support for these cuts and his cavalier dismissal of how this serious situation is affecting Virginians.

We need to stand up for Virginia’s hardworking public servants.

The Virginia House of Delegates Emergency Committee on Federal Workforce and Funding Reductions has begun its work. I look forward to its legislative and budgetary recommendations and am committed to doing everything we can to provide relief to impacted Virginians and our communities.
